Why Chelsea Expected More From Nkunku-Maresca

Chelsea boss, Enzo Maresca, has said that the club expects more from Christopher Nkunku.

Maresca also said that he was pleased with the Frenchman’s performance in Chelsea’s Premier League 4-0 win over Southampton on Tuesday.

Chelsea defeated Southampton, thanks to goals from Nkunku, Pedro Neto, Levi Colwill and Marc Cucurella.

The win ended Chelsea’s three-game winless run and moved them back into the Premier League top four.

Asked for his assessment of Nkunku’s display, Maresca told TNT Sports: “I’m happy with him, I know that he can give more. We expect more from him.

“At the same time, we try to understand him in terms of he is not a nine. Many games he plays as a nine. He is not a winger and tonight he played as a winger.

“He is an attacking midfielder. The problem is that sometimes to find balance… we already used Cole Palmer there so we try to use him in different positions.”

Chelsea’s next game is against Copenhagen in the Europa Conference League Round of 16 tie on March 6.
